What You Should Say To Yourself Every Morning As You Look In The Mirror

This morning, I’d like you wake up and run…no, not outside, but to the bathroom. Close the door and look at yourself in the mirror. Really look at yourself. I’m not talking about the new pimple you just found or the fact that you really ought to have shaven yesterday, but look at your eyes and smile. You are a gift. Yes, you are gift to yourself and to the world. And I want you to ask yourself, “Why do you think that your Creator, whatever it may be that you believe in, is so grateful to have you in its life?” Yes, of course we should be grateful to our higher being, but think about how grateful He or She is for you.

What have you done, or are doing now, to make your world a better place for you and the people around you? Think about all the wonderful things you have done and focus on that today and smile. You deserve to be here on this planet, and the Universe is grateful for having you here in its realms.
